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an said he had successful negotiations with his French counterpart Emmanuel Macron, Report informs referring to RIA Novosti.
"We had a very good conversation with my French colleague Macron, discussed bilateral relations, regional and international problems," Erdogan said.
The Turkish politician stressed the great potential of relations between the countries.
He also said that Ankara will move in solidarity with France, including in the fight against terrorism.
